North R’veldt man denies stoning woman’s house

A 62-year-old man was on Thursday summoned to answer two charges at the Georgetown Magistrates’ Court, including stoning a woman’s house.

It is alleged that Dennis Maloney, on August 2, at 3437 Jacksonville, North Ruimveldt, used abusive language towards Joan Blake and also on the same day he threw bricks on the roof of her home.

He pleaded not guilty to both charges

Maloney told the court that it was Blake who was the trouble maker and not him. “These people throwing bricks on my house and garbage in my yard. They even broke in and stole my belongings,” he added.

With no objections to bail from Prosecutor Vishnu Hunt, Maloney was released on $5,000 bail on each charge.

The case will be called on September 9 at Court One.
